Output 3482bf67058fd5e607beccd5dd0542e558c0fe2a3ec8356340be421540ac0399:1

value
35184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d31153e9cf2b27e1d96c61ee1831c52bcf9dda OP_EQUAL
address
9uX7oxe56qZtwNVQxtEtseNirJgTEjqo29
transaction
3482bf67058fd5e607beccd5dd0542e558c0fe2a3ec8356340be421540ac0399